All 3 Sections of the Jimmy Page Intro. Fender Telecaster with DiMarzio Twang King pickups into Fender Princeton Reverb Reissue (PRRI) with Eminence Legend 1058.

  • If you're having trouble with the barre chords, you can play a simpler version of the Dmaj7 by barring just the first 3 strings at the 2nd fret (like an F#m) and then play the simple open-position version of the Cmaj7 I show in the video.

  • It might be easier to do that A to Dm riff if you finger the A chord this way: middle finger on E (4th string), index on A (3th), ring on C# (2nd). That way, you just move your middle and ring fingers up one fret to made the Dm chord, and the index finger never has to move. I also believe this fingering for the A chord makes it easier to play the chord in tune.
